Output 21f6cf5ed68057fbb093dec0e3c12d59a0bd63e7812d0d1841b84539a10f5c76:6

value
504552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bdad2dda5829b1d6bda6090577e91fa24cc24bc OP_EQUAL
address
3Qehfq6V8ytoTPSkKdUdvLGLMumor5HHnS
transaction
21f6cf5ed68057fbb093dec0e3c12d59a0bd63e7812d0d1841b84539a10f5c76
spent
true